Weihrauch HW45
Weihrauch HW45 is a spring-piston air pistol designed and manufactured by Hermann Weihrauch Revolver GmbH, a German company known for its high-quality air guns and firearms. The HW45 is notable for its robust construction, high power, and accuracy, making it popular among target shooters and airgun enthusiasts.
Design and Features
The Weihrauch HW45 is a single-shot, spring-piston air pistol that closely resembles a traditional semi-automatic pistol in appearance. However, it operates on a very different principle. The HW45 is powered by a spring mechanism, which is cocked by breaking the pistol at its breech. This design is often referred to as a break-barrel configuration.
One of the distinctive features of the HW45 is its two-stage power setting, allowing shooters to choose between two levels of power by varying the cocking stroke. This feature is particularly useful for adjusting the pistol's performance based on the shooting distance or the type of target.
The pistol is equipped with adjustable rear sights for both windage and elevation, enhancing its accuracy. The front sight is fixed. The HW45 also features a manual safety, located conveniently near the trigger, ensuring safe handling.
The grip of the HW45 is ergonomically designed, providing a comfortable and secure hold. It is available in various finishes, including wood and synthetic materials, catering to different preferences.
Performance
The Weihrauch HW45 is renowned for its exceptional accuracy and power. It is capable of firing .177 (4.5mm) or .22 (5.5mm) caliber pellets at velocities that are among the highest for air pistols without requiring a CO2 or pneumatic power source. This makes the HW45 suitable for various shooting disciplines, including target shooting and plinking.
Variants
The HW45 is available in several variants, differing primarily in their finishes and grip materials. Some models also feature different barrel lengths, affecting the pistol's overall balance and performance.
